Very interesting that it's working in Copilot Studio, but the same copilot is not working in Teams....
Try this: Turn on tracking in the copilot while you are testing in Copilot Studio. Make a note of the topics that are triggered during the expected conversation results. Go back to Teams and ensure that those topics are running there as well, look for any dependencies that might be missing (connectors etc.), and check the security settings (authentication details). This should help you pinpoint which specific topic is not triggering in Teams so that you can resolve the variance.
